Ingredients
- 650 g Wholemeal spelt flour
- 1 cube Fresh yeast
- 1 tsp Sugar
- 1 tsp Salt
- 2 tbsp Sesame seeds
- 2 tbsp Oil
- 400 ml Lukewarm water
- Sesame seeds to sprinkle
Instructions
- 2 Cover baking trays with baking paper. Roast 2 tablespoons of sesame seeds in a pan without fat, pour onto a plate and allow to cool.
- Dissolve the yeast with 1 teaspoon sugar.
- Mix the flour, salt and sesame seeds in a bowl. Add the oil and the dissolved yeast with the lukewarm water and knead with the mixer with a dough hook.
- Cover and let rise in a warm place for about 40 minutes.
- Then knead again. Separate small balls, knead again, form balls and sprinkle with sesame seeds. Place on a baking sheet, leave a little space.
- Bake at 180 degrees hot air for about 20-25 minutes, then remove from the tray and let cool down.
- Depending on the size, the amount of dough is 10-12 pieces.
